  • Key to Improving Energy Efficiency in Compressor Motor Magnetization: How Does the ‘Internal Magnetization’ Process Work?

    2284

    In industrial production, compressor motors are core equipment for maintaining refrigeration and pneumatic system operations. However, after long-term operation, they are prone to ‘demagnetization’ due to high temperatures and vibration — the magnetism of the internal motor magnets weakens, leading not only to increased energy consumption but also to frequent start-stop cycles, elevated noise, and other issues. The JIUJU compressor motor magnetization technology enhances energy efficiency by…

  • Four-Station Motor Magnetizers: How Multi-Station Synchronous Technology Simplifies Magnetization + Testing Processes

    2060

    In motor manufacturing, magnetization and testing are critical steps to ensure magnetic steel performance. Traditional single- or dual-station magnetizers often face workflow fragmentation — after magnetization, components must be manually transferred to testing equipment, causing downtime and potentially affecting magnet stability during handling. The JIUJU four-station motor magnetizer uses multi-station synchronous technology to restructure the workflow, integrating magnetization and testing…
